mirror of
https://github.com/FEX-Emu/linux.git
synced 2024-12-24 02:18:54 +00:00
0b83ddebc6
New MFD child to twl4030 MFD device. Reason for the twl4030_codec MFD: the vibra control is actually in the codec part of the twl4030. If both the vibra and the audio functionality is needed from the twl4030 at the same time, than they need to control the codec power and APLL at the same time without breaking the other driver. Also these two has to be able to work without the need for the other driver. This MFD device will be used by the drivers, which needs resources from the twl4030 codec like audio and vibra. The platform specific configuration data is passed along to the child drivers (audio, vibra). Signed-off-by: Peter Ujfalusi <peter.ujfalusi@nokia.com> Acked-by: Samuel Ortiz <sameo@linux.intel.com> Signed-off-by: Mark Brown <broonie@opensource.wolfsonmicro.com>
54 lines
1.5 KiB
Makefile
54 lines
1.5 KiB
Makefile
#
|
|
# Makefile for multifunction miscellaneous devices
|
|
#
|
|
|
|
obj-$(CONFIG_MFD_SM501) += sm501.o
|
|
obj-$(CONFIG_MFD_ASIC3) += asic3.o
|
|
|
|
obj-$(CONFIG_HTC_EGPIO) += htc-egpio.o
|
|
obj-$(CONFIG_HTC_PASIC3) += htc-pasic3.o
|
|
|
|
obj-$(CONFIG_MFD_DM355EVM_MSP) += dm355evm_msp.o
|
|
|
|
obj-$(CONFIG_MFD_T7L66XB) += t7l66xb.o
|
|
obj-$(CONFIG_MFD_TC6387XB) += tc6387xb.o
|
|
obj-$(CONFIG_MFD_TC6393XB) += tc6393xb.o
|
|
|
|
obj-$(CONFIG_MFD_WM8400) += wm8400-core.o
|
|
wm831x-objs := wm831x-core.o wm831x-irq.o wm831x-otp.o
|
|
obj-$(CONFIG_MFD_WM831X) += wm831x.o
|
|
wm8350-objs := wm8350-core.o wm8350-regmap.o wm8350-gpio.o
|
|
obj-$(CONFIG_MFD_WM8350) += wm8350.o
|
|
obj-$(CONFIG_MFD_WM8350_I2C) += wm8350-i2c.o
|
|
|
|
obj-$(CONFIG_TPS65010) += tps65010.o
|
|
obj-$(CONFIG_MENELAUS) += menelaus.o
|
|
|
|
obj-$(CONFIG_TWL4030_CORE) += twl4030-core.o twl4030-irq.o
|
|
obj-$(CONFIG_TWL4030_POWER) += twl4030-power.o
|
|
obj-$(CONFIG_TWL4030_CODEC) += twl4030-codec.o
|
|
|
|
obj-$(CONFIG_MFD_MC13783) += mc13783-core.o
|
|
|
|
obj-$(CONFIG_MFD_CORE) += mfd-core.o
|
|
|
|
obj-$(CONFIG_EZX_PCAP) += ezx-pcap.o
|
|
|
|
obj-$(CONFIG_MCP) += mcp-core.o
|
|
obj-$(CONFIG_MCP_SA11X0) += mcp-sa11x0.o
|
|
obj-$(CONFIG_MCP_UCB1200) += ucb1x00-core.o
|
|
obj-$(CONFIG_MCP_UCB1200_TS) += ucb1x00-ts.o
|
|
|
|
ifeq ($(CONFIG_SA1100_ASSABET),y)
|
|
obj-$(CONFIG_MCP_UCB1200) += ucb1x00-assabet.o
|
|
endif
|
|
obj-$(CONFIG_UCB1400_CORE) += ucb1400_core.o
|
|
|
|
obj-$(CONFIG_PMIC_DA903X) += da903x.o
|
|
|
|
obj-$(CONFIG_MFD_PCF50633) += pcf50633-core.o
|
|
obj-$(CONFIG_PCF50633_ADC) += pcf50633-adc.o
|
|
obj-$(CONFIG_PCF50633_GPIO) += pcf50633-gpio.o
|
|
obj-$(CONFIG_AB3100_CORE) += ab3100-core.o
|
|
obj-$(CONFIG_AB3100_OTP) += ab3100-otp.o
|